Procedural Posture

Constitutional Petition / Withdrawal Ruling

  1. 1 Whether the petition should be marked as withdrawn upon the applicant's notice of withdrawal and absence of objection from the respondents.
  2. 2 Whether costs should be awarded or each party should bear their own costs.

Ratio Decidendi

The court found that the petitioner had filed a notice of withdrawal of the entire petition, and there was no objection from the 1st and 2nd respondents, while the 3rd to 6th respondents neither appeared nor objected. In the absence of any contest or objection, and in exercise of its discretion, the court marked the petition as wholly withdrawn and ordered that each party bear their own costs. The file was ordered closed, bringing the proceedings to an end.
